Leisure Time Products Recalls Brutus Swing Sets Due to Injury Hazard (Recall Alert)

- What was recalled
- This recall involves Backyard Discovery Big Brutus, Little Brutus and Mini Brutus metal swing sets with the following manufacture codes: 03/2019-O, 02/2020-T, 03/2020-T, 04/2020-T, 05/2020-O, and 07/2020-O; and manufacture dates March 2019 through July 2020. The swing sets have a green top tube with white legs and green cross braces. The manufacture code and manufacture date are located on the label on the leg of the swing set.
- The hazard
- The attachment that connects the swing hanger to the top tube can fail, posing an injury hazard.
- Injuries
- Leisure Time Products has received three reports of the swing hanger attachment failing, which resulted in one side of the swing falling. No injuries have been reported.
- The remedy
-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led swing sets and contact Leisure Time Products for a free repair kit. Leisure Time Products is contacting all purchasers directly.

What a recall entitles you to
A refund, a repair or a replacement. The notice says which. It costs you
nothing and there is usually no receipt requirement.
Stop using the product first. Recalls do not expire. An old one still counts.
